Peptide therapy involves the administration of synthetic or natural peptides to treat various health conditions.
Peptide therapies are diverse and can be broadly categorized by their function and the health goals they address. The types range from naturally occurring supplements to prescription drugs approved for specific medical conditions.
Common types and their applications include:
Growth Hormone (GH) Related Peptides
These peptides stimulate the body’s natural production of human growth hormone, which helps with muscle growth, fat loss, and tissue repair.
- CJC-1295 / Ipamorelin: Often used in combination, they boost GH and IGF-1 levels, improving muscle mass, energy, and sleep quality.
- Sermorelin: Stimulates the pituitary gland to release more GH, supporting overall vitality and recovery.
Healing and Recovery Peptides
These peptides are known for their regenerative properties and anti-inflammatory effects, often used by athletes or individuals recovering from injury.
- BPC-157 (Body Protection Compound 157):Derived from stomach protein, it accelerates the healing of muscles, tendons, ligaments, and the gut lining.
Weight Management and Metabolic Peptides
These peptides help regulate metabolism, appetite, and blood sugar levels.
- Semaglutide (Ozempic, Wegovy): A GLP-1 receptor agonist that mimics a natural gut hormone, enhancing insulin secretion and suppressing appetite for weight loss and type 2 diabetes management.
- AOD 9604: A fragment of the HGH molecule that specifically targets and accelerates fat breakdown without impacting blood sugar levels.
- NAD: A metabolic coenzyme that supports cellular energy production, mitochondrial function, and overall vitality.
Skin Health and Anti-Aging Peptides
Used in cosmetics and therapy to promote collagen and elastin production, improving skin elasticity and reducing wrinkles.
- Collagen Peptides: Available as oral supplements or in creams, they improve skin hydration, elasticity, and support joint health.
- GHK-Cu (Copper Peptides): Known to improve skin texture, firmness, and reduce skin laxity
Administration Methods:
- Peptide therapy can be administered through various methods, including injections, nasal sprays, topical creams, and oral supplements.
